Project Description:

           

This project will focus on designing an Electrical Power System (EPS) applicable for the SpaceBuoy mission as well as future small-satellite missions. The EPS includes the power regulation and control for the spacecraft, the flight-inhibit subsystem, solar arrays, batteries, and monitoring of power consumed by other spacecraft systems. The new EPS will omit some of the unnecessary functionality of previously designed systems, and add some features that will improve the overall performance and compatibility of the system. One of the main goals of this project is to create an EPS that is configurable for future SSEL small-satellite programs, in both Cubesat and Nanosat applications.
